Top 5 Food and Diet Tracking Apps on iOS in Latin America for Q2 2022
Discover the performance of the top 5 food and diet tracking applications on iOS in Latin America during Q2 2022, including insights on we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
In Q2 2022, the top food and diet tracking apps on iOS in Latin America showcased varying tr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Data from Sensor Tower reveals significant insights into the performance of these applications.
MyFitnessPal: Calorie Counter saw consistent weekly revenue growth, peaking at around $19.8K in the last week of June. Downloads fluctuated, reaching a high of approximately 11.8K in the same week. Active users showed a steady increase from 457K to 465K throughout the quarter.
BodyFast: Intermittent Fasting experienced notable weekly revenue, peaking at about $17.3K in the final week of June. Downloads also varied, with a high of around 9.9K in late May. Active users increased from 21.8K to 23.5K over the quarter.
Fastic: Food & Calorie Tracker showed a stable revenue trend, reaching a peak of around $11K in mid-June. Weekly downloads saw a significant rise, peaking at 11.3K in late June. Active users also increased, reaching a high of approximately 48K in mid-June.
Fastin: Intermittent Fasting demonstrated a strong revenue growth, peaking at around $11.8K in the last week of June. Downloads saw a peak of about 20K in mid-June. Active users showed a steady rise from 32.5K to 98.4K over the quarter.
Intermittent Fasting Tracker ⋆ had a relatively stable revenue, peaking at approximately $6.8K in early April. Downloads varied, with a high of around 7.2K in mid-May. Active users remained consistent, peaking at about 61K in mid-April.
